3.

INCOMING RING

Sets whether or not to activate the ring alert of the handset or

 

 

 

an external telephone if <RX MODE> is set to <FaxOnly>.

 

 

 

Selecting <ON> allows you to learn the fax reception and

 

 

 

answer voice calls if you pick up the handset or an external

 

 

 

telephone while it is ringing.

 

 

ON

The handset or an external telephone rings.

 

 

 

 

 

 

RING COUNT

Sets the number of incoming rings before the machine answers.

 

 

 

(1TIMES–16TIMES (2TIMES))

 

 

 

 

 

 

OFF

The handset or an external telephone does not ring. (In the

 

 

 

Sleep mode, the handset or an external telephone may ring one

 

 

 

or two times.)

5.

RX PRINT

Sets whether to store all received pages in memory before

 

 

 

 

printing them out or print each page as it is received. (See

 

 

 

Chapter 3, “Sending and Receiving,” in the Reference Guide.)

 

 

MEMORY RX

Print after all the pages of the document are received.

 

 

 

 

 

 

PRINT RX

Print each page as it is received.
